The Quiet Son 2025 (6.544)

Pierre, a devoted father in his 50s, raises his two sons alone. When Louis, the youngest, leaves home to attend the Sorbonne in Paris, Fus, slightly older and not as successful academically, becomes more and more secretive. Driven by a fascination for violence, he gets entangled in far-right extremist groups, at the very opposite of his father’s values. Between them, there is love and hate, until tragedy happens.

Heavy Load 2019 (6.5)

The two estranged brothers Emil and Magnus travel to Spain to bring home the body of their drunken and now dead father. What Emil doesn’t know is that Magnus has only agreed to go because of their father’s valuable Rolex watch which can save his bleeding finances. But when it turns out the transportation of the body will cost more than 10,000 Euro, Magnus convinces his reluctant little brother to run away with the body hidden in a roof box on top of a way too small rental car. Soon the two brothers find themselves on a wild escape from the police, and their father’s last trip forces them to face their own problems.

Lingua Amoris N/A (10)

It begins with a chance encounter between Ro and Ju on a film set. A conventional love film? The characters not only change bodies, identities and desires over seven countries. They struggle with perceptions of themselves and others, fail because of bad scripts, a lack of visas, social expectations or their own demands. The film shows that love is both individual and universal at the same time. It shows diversity in action and not only dispels prejudices about gender relations and sexism in different corners of the world, but also touches on topical issues such as the war in Ukraine. The film is an ode to love and a declaration of love to filmmaking. Film sets, the madness and confusion of film production and the excitement before the premiere are also themes of the film.

Deux Semaines De Juin 2020

June 10, 1940 on the Franco-Italian front line; Anguish, expectation, and doubt over what to do with the fight weighed on Sergeant MARTIN and his unit. Would the conflict not also relate to the soldier's sense of duty and the conscience of each man?
